Education Requirements for a Network Integration Engineer
To become a Network Integration Engineer in India, a combination of formal education, certifications, and practical experience is typically required. Here’s a detailed breakdown:
-
Bachelor's Degree:
- A bachelor's degree in Computer Science, Information Technology, Electrical Engineering, or a related field is essential. This provides a strong foundation in networking concepts, programming, and system administration.
-
Relevant Coursework:
- Focus on courses such as data structures, algorithms, computer networks, operating systems, and network security. These courses provide the theoretical knowledge needed for network integration.
-
Certifications:
- Cisco Certified Network Associate (CCNA): A widely recognized certification that validates your understanding of basic networking concepts and Cisco equipment.
- Cisco Certified Network Professional (CCNP): An advanced certification that demonstrates expertise in network implementation and troubleshooting.
- CompTIA Network+: A vendor-neutral certification that covers a broad range of networking topics.
- Juniper Networks Certified Internet Associate (JNCIA): If you plan to work with Juniper networks, this certification is valuable.
-
Master's Degree (Optional):
- A master's degree in a related field can provide more advanced knowledge and skills, which can be beneficial for career advancement and specialized roles.
-
Practical Experience:
- Internships or entry-level positions in networking are crucial for gaining hands-on experience. Look for opportunities to work on network design, implementation, and troubleshooting.
-
Key Skills:
- Proficiency in networking protocols (TCP/IP, DNS, DHCP, etc.).
- Experience with network hardware (routers, switches, firewalls).
- Knowledge of network security principles and practices.
- Familiarity with network monitoring and management tools.
- Strong problem-solving and analytical skills.
- Excellent communication and teamwork abilities.

Fees
The fees for courses and certifications required to become a Network Integration Engineer in India can vary widely depending on the type of institution, course level, and mode of study (online vs. in-person). Here’s a breakdown of the typical costs:
-
Bachelor's Degree:
- Government Colleges: ₹20,000 - ₹50,000 per year
- Private Colleges: ₹80,000 - ₹3,00,000 per year
-
Master's Degree:
- Government Colleges: ₹30,000 - ₹70,000 per year
- Private Colleges: ₹1,00,000 - ₹5,00,000 per year
-
CCNA Certification:
- Training Courses: ₹10,000 - ₹25,000 (depending on the institute and course duration)
- Exam Fee: Approximately ₹20,000 (USD 300)
-
CCNP Certification:
- Training Courses: ₹15,000 - ₹35,000 (depending on the institute and course duration)
- Exam Fee: Approximately ₹20,000 - ₹30,000 per exam (CCNP requires passing multiple exams)
-
CompTIA Network+ Certification:
- Training Courses: ₹8,000 - ₹20,000
- Exam Fee: Approximately ₹20,000 (USD 300)
-
Online Courses:
- Platforms like Coursera, Udemy, and edX offer various networking courses. Fees can range from ₹2,000 to ₹20,000 per course, depending on the duration and content.
-
Bootcamps:
- Intensive training programs that can cost between ₹50,000 and ₹1,50,000, offering comprehensive training in a short period.
Related Exams
To excel as a Network Integration Engineer, several key exams and certifications can significantly boost your career prospects. These exams validate your knowledge and skills, making you a more attractive candidate for employers.
-
Cisco Certified Network Associate (CCNA):
- Description: This is an entry-level certification that covers basic networking concepts, IP addressing, routing, switching, and network security. It's a great starting point for anyone looking to build a career in networking.
- Importance: Demonstrates a foundational understanding of networking principles and Cisco equipment.
-
Cisco Certified Network Professional (CCNP):
- Description: This is an advanced certification that focuses on more complex networking topics such as routing, switching, security, and network design. It requires a deeper understanding of networking technologies and protocols.
- Importance: Validates expertise in implementing, maintaining, and troubleshooting complex networks.
-
CompTIA Network+:
- Description: A vendor-neutral certification that covers a broad range of networking topics, including network hardware, software, protocols, and security. It's a good option for those who want a general understanding of networking.
- Importance: Provides a solid foundation in networking concepts and technologies.
-
Juniper Networks Certified Internet Associate (JNCIA):
- Description: This certification focuses on Juniper Networks technologies and is designed for individuals who work with Juniper equipment. It covers basic networking concepts and Juniper device configuration.
- Importance: Demonstrates proficiency in Juniper Networks technologies.
-
Certified Information Systems Security Professional (CISSP):
- Description: While not strictly a networking certification, CISSP is highly valuable for Network Integration Engineers who work with network security. It covers a wide range of security topics, including access control, cryptography, and security management.
- Importance: Validates expertise in information security and risk management.
